These are fake.
Swoosh has a bad shape and is too thick. The leather material is off, the orange looks like it’s the wrong shade, the sail leather looks too white.

I think the difference in swoosh shape and material between mine and yours is visible, Nike does not get the shape of the swoosh wrong. I don't think you understand how good the current fakes are. The top tier fakes use very similar materials, have very similar shape, and make minimal flaws. That's why you pay places like StockX. Most people cant tell the difference between a fake and a retail pair, even people that buy Jordan's regularly, that's why StockX has become as big as it is.
